Creamy Burger Casserole Recipe
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 ½ pound of ground beef
- 1 jar home-style Alfredo sauce (14.5 ounces)
- 1 medium tomato (chopped – about 1 cup)
- 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
- ½ c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 package refrigerated biscuit dough (7.5 ounces 10 biscuits)
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 400F and lightly spray a 1 ½ quart casserole dish with cooking spray.
- In a large skillet over medium-high heat cook burger until no longer pink inside; drain any excess fat. Stir in the Alfredo sauce, Worcestershire sauce, and tomato. Bring mixture to a boil, reduce heat to simmer, and continue cooking for 5 minutes; pour meat mixture into casserole dish.
- Sprinkle the cheese over the top and arrange the biscuits on top of the cheese.
- Bake for 10 minutes or until biscuits is nicely browned.
- Serve hot.
